Description
Blueberry scorch is a viral disease caused by the Blueberry scorch virus (BlScV), a member of the Carlavirus genus. It represents a significant threat to the production of highbush blueberries and cranberries, as it can cause substantial yield losses and weaken entire plantations over several growing seasons.
The virus affects both blueberry and cranberry crops. Once a plant is infected, the virus becomes systemic, spreading through the vascular tissues. This makes infected plants a continuous source of infection for neighboring healthy bushes, eventually leading to reduced fruit production and compromised plant vigor.
Symptoms are most distinct during the flowering stage. Affected bushes display a sudden blighting of blossoms, which turn brown or black and wither without falling off. This is often accompanied by yellowing of the foliage and marginal leaf necrosis. The severity of these symptoms can vary depending on the plant cultivar and environmental conditions.
The virus is primarily transmitted by various species of aphids. These vectors acquire the virus while feeding on infected plant sap and transmit it to healthy bushes during subsequent feedings. The spread is facilitated by warm conditions that promote aphid activity and high planting densities that allow for easy movement of the vectors between bushes.
Management of blueberry scorch is strictly preventative, as there is no chemical cure for the virus. Growers should prioritize the purchase of virus-indexed, certified nursery stock. Effective control involves constant scouting for symptomatic plants, immediate rogueing and destruction of infected bushes, and rigorous integrated pest management to keep aphid populations below the economic threshold.
